Origins and Construction: Sarasin Bridge

Sarasin Bridge, named after the former Governor of Phuket, Thanom Sarasin, was inaugurated in 1967, marking a historic milestone in the development of the region’s infrastructure.

The bridge, spanning a length of 700 meters, was designed to connect Phuket Island to the mainland province of facilitating transportation and trade between the two regions.

Its construction marked the end of an era when travel between Phuket and the mainland was primarily by ferry, providing a vital link for the island’s growing population and burgeoning tourism industry.

Scenic Beauty and Tourism: Sarasin Bridge

In addition to its practical function, Sarasin Bridge offers breathtaking views of the Andaman Sea and the surrounding coastline, making it a popular destination for tourists and photographers.

Visitors can stroll along the pedestrian walkway, taking in the sights and sounds of the ocean breeze and marveling at the natural beauty of the area.

Sunset views from Sarasin Bridge are particularly stunning, as the sky transforms into a canvas of vibrant colors, casting an ethereal glow over the tranquil waters below.
